We perform two-Tone spectroscopy on quantum circuits, where high-frequency radiation is generated by a voltage-biased superconductor-normal-superconductor Josephson junction and detection is carried out by an ancillary microwave resonator. We implement this protocol on two different systems, a transmon qubit and a λ/4 resonator. We demonstrate that this two-Tone Josephson spectroscopy operates well into the millimeter-wave band, reaching frequencies larger than 80 GHz, and is well suited for probing highly coherent quantum systems.
